Preparing for a software engineering interview can be overwhelming. Here are seven tips you can use to prepare for an interview.

Firstly, examine the job description. The job description is the foundation of your interview preparation. It will give you a clear understanding of the skills and experience needed for the role.

As you prepare, take note of the keywords, skills, and experience required and tailor your responses to highlight your relevant skills and experience. HGS, for example, values people with strong technical skills and customer service experience.

Then, assess your motive for applying to the job. Companies are looking for applicants who are genuinely interested in the role and the organization.

Research the company's values, mission, culture, and recent developments to demonstrate your enthusiasm and alignment with the company's goals. Show the interviewer that you understand the role and are excited about how you can contribute to the team.

Third, research the company and your desired role. Another way to prepare for an interview is to research the company and role you are applying for. This will show the interviewer that you are serious about the job.

Spend time researching the company, its history, products, and services, and any recent news or developments. By doing so, you can gain insight into the company's goals and challenges and how you can contribute to its success.

Tip number four is to prepare common interview questions. This can help you feel more confident and less nervous during the interview.

Research the most commonly asked interview questions specific to the role you are applying for. These may seek to discern your strengths, weaknesses, experience with particular technologies, and problem-solving skills.

Preparing your answers in advance can help you come across as more composed and polished during the interview process. At HGS, candidates with a talent for resolving problems and expertise in the technology and CX industries are highly valued.

Let's come to tip number five. Work on your voice and body language. The way you speak and your body language can significantly influence the impression you make during an interview.

Practice speaking clearly and confidently and maintain good eye contact with your interviewer. Pay attention to your body language too, sit up straight, avoid fidgeting, and try to project a positive and engaged demeanor.

Tip number six, be prepared to ask thoughtful questions. The interviewer will likely ask if you have any questions for them. This is an excellent opportunity to show your interest and engagement with the company and the role.

Prepare questions demonstrating your curiosity and enthusiasm, such as the company's goals for the next few years or how the team collaborates on projects. HGS values applicants who can bring clients innovative ideas and creative solutions.

And lastly, tip number seven, conduct mock interviews. It is an excellent opportunity to assess your readiness for the actual interview and help you identify areas where you can improve.

Ask a friend or family member to conduct a mock interview with you and simulate the interview as closely as possible. This will help you feel more comfortable and confident during the actual interview.
